As of January 15, 2015, Facebook is going to show fewer of your posts to your friends, reports retail specialist Carol Schroeder. "...customers are not going to see what you post unless you pay," says Ms. Schroeder.

Carol Schroeder wrote this neat article below about how to price items.
The article reports that services like FeedVisor automatically change your Amazon.com prices, and services like Savored, from Groupon, let restaurants offer a percentage off a meal if the diner comes in at a certian hour.
Maybe a retailer can mimick this and offer a disount when shopping between 2 pm - 4 pm?
